Reading Specialist Credential

Open to those who already hold a California teaching credential, the California Reading Specialist credential provides educators with the specialized skills they need to better understand not only literacy and reading issues, but also the instructional aspects related to literacy.  Program graduates will be prepared to take on leadership roles in materials selection, literacy program development, and professional and staff development at the school, district, and county levels.

Candidates who already hold either an MA in Child and Adolescent Literacy or a Reading Certificate can apply their previous coursework to this program's course requirements.


Program Coursework

  • EDUC 6103  Curriculum and Instructional Leadership
  • EDUC 6105  Assessment and Research Methodology
  • EDUC 6311  Advanced Issues in Assessment and Instruction
  • EDUC 6340  Educational Linguistics
  • EDUC 6341  Foundations of Literacy Instruction
  • EDUC 6342  Diagnosing and Developing Literacy Skills
  • EDUC 6343  Practicum in Diagnosing and Developing Literacy Skills
  • EDUC 6344  Seminar in Literacy Leadership and Professional Development
  • EDUC 6346  Advanced Practicum: Diagnosis and Intervention in Reading/Language Arts Instruction
  • EDUC 6347  Research and Trends in Literacy and Learning
  • EDUC 6348  Field Experiences in Professional Literacy Leadership
